How does a Local Server coordinate with the kitchen and front-of-house teams to ensure a smooth dining experience?

As a Local Server, effective communication with both the kitchen and front-of-house teams is crucial to delivering a seamless dining experience. Servers are responsible for accurately relaying guest orders to the kitchen and promptly following up on any special dietary requests or changes. They also work closely with hosts, bussers, and bartenders to ensure tables are set, drinks are served in a timely manner, and any guest concerns are addressed quickly. This collaborative approach helps minimize errors, reduces wait times, and enhances overall customer satisfaction.

Job description

Job Overview

In alignment with Gallaher Signature Livingโ€™s mission and values, the Server delivers an elevated dining experience that reflects the communityโ€™s boutique hospitality standards. The Server is responsible for providing attentive, gracious, and professional food and beverage service to residents, family members, and guests while maintaining a clean, safe, and welcoming dining environment. All duties are performed in compliance with Company policies and procedures and all applicable federal, state, and local regulations, including Title 22.

Compensation: $18.75-$21.50/hour

Open Availability Preferredย 

Key Responsibilities

  • Provide refined, courteous, and efficient meal service to residents, family members, and guests, ensuring dignity, respect, and personalized attention always.
  • Serve, prepare, and replenish beveragesโ€”including water, coffee, tea, soda, wine, beer, and cocktailsโ€”using appropriate glassware and presentation standards.
  • Open, pour, and serve wine and beer in accordance with responsible alcohol service guidelines, as applicable.
  • Stock and maintain bar areas with wine, beer, spirits, mixers, and garnishes; communicate inventory needs to the Executive Chef or designee.
  • Accurately take and enter food and beverage orders into the Point of Sale (POS) system, including residentsโ€™ meals, guest dining, employee meals, and to-go orders.
  • Verify accuracy of all orders prior to service, including special requests, dietary needs, and menu substitutions.
  • Demonstrate thorough knowledge of menus, daily specials, ingredients, and preparation methods to confidently assist residents and guests with menu selections.
  • Ensure plates are attractively presented prior to service and deliver meals using proper tray service techniques, tray stands, and delivery procedures.
  • Follow established fine-dining service standards and etiquette, including appropriate table service, course clearing, and guest engagement.
  • Prepare and maintain dining room tables and service stations with proper linens, china, glassware, flatware, condiments, and service supplies.
  • Reset and โ€œflipโ€ tables promptly and professionally to support smooth dining service.
  • Clear and bus tables efficiently; transport dishes to the kitchen and assist with dishwashing or kitchen support as needed.
  • Maintain a clean, sanitary, and organized work environment at all times in accordance with food safety and sanitation standards.
  • Assist with meal delivery to resident apartments as required.
  • Interact with residents in a warm, respectful, and attentive manner, recognizing each resident as an individual and responding thoughtfully to preferences and needs.
  • Address resident questions or concerns with professionalism and empathy, escalating matters to leadership when appropriate.
  • Support the communityโ€™s hospitality and marketing efforts through positive engagement during tours, events, and interactions with prospective residents and guests.
  • Foster a culture of teamwork and collaboration across departments to ensure a seamless resident experience.
  • Maintain a safe, secure environment for residents, guests, and team members by adhering to all established safety protocols, including:
  • Illness and Injury Prevention Program (IIPP)
  • Universal Precautions and Bloodborne Pathogens
  • Emergency, Evacuation, and Disaster Preparedness Plans
  • Resident Elopement Prevention Procedures
  • Promptly report occupational exposure to blood, bodily fluids, infectious materials, or hazardous chemicals in accordance with Company policy.
  • Observe and report any changes in a residentโ€™s condition following established procedures.
  • Complete all required training, certifications, in-services, and meetings as mandated by state licensure and Company standards, including compliance with Title 22 regulations.
  • Participate in daily department โ€œStand-Upโ€ meetings to support communication and operational excellence.
  • Perform additional duties as assigned to meet operational and resident care needs.

Qualifications & Requirements

  • Must be at least eighteen (18) years of age.
  • High school diploma or equivalent preferred.
  • Minimum of six (6) months of experience in food and beverage service preferred; hospitality or fine-dining experience a plus.
  • Ability to safely operate food service equipment and utensils commonly used in professional dining environments.
  • Knowledge of, or willingness to learn, assisted living operations and dementia awareness.
  • Demonstrated ability to work compassionately and patiently with older adults, including individuals with cognitive impairment.
  • Ability to operate standard office and facility equipment, including POS systems and timekeeping devices.
  • Strong communication skills; ability to read, write, and speak English effectively.
  • Highly motivated, dependable, and able to work both independently and as part of a team.
  • Ability to obtain and maintain required certifications, including Food Handlerโ€™s Permit and First Aid/CPR, as applicable.
  • Must successfully pass all required background checks, health screenings, and immunization requirements in accordance with Company policy and applicable law.
